Emma Roberts gets real about 'dark nights' after becoming a mom
Emma Roberts admitted motherhood changed her 'in every way'
Emma Roberts is opening up about how the challenges that came with being a mother shaped her.
In a recent chat with Harper's Bazaar Spain, the 34-year-old star candidly spoke about how becoming a mom to her son Rhodes has changed her in both personal and professional life.
"Motherhood has given me so much depth in my emotions and understanding, both personally and professionally. Seeing everything through his eyes is beautiful and transforms your perspective on the world," she began.
The Scream Queens star went on to say, "I also find it inspiring for my work. I've had some dark nights postpartum. Using those emotions creatively is interesting."
"My son is about to turn five, and I feel like I'm still discovering who I am, as a person and as a mother. I try to do my best, although I don't always succeed, but I try," The American Horror Story actress added.
It is pertinent to mention that Roberts welcomed Rhodes back in December 2020 with ex Garrett Hedlund. However, after Rhodes's first birthday, Roberts and Hedlund parted their ways.
Now, Roberts is engaged to new partner Cody John.
